herokuにpushすると謎のエラーが出た話

NO IMAGE

herokuにpushすると謎のエラーが出た話

$ git push heroku master

remote: Compressing source files... done.
remote: Building source:
remote: 
remote: -----> PHP app detected
remote: -----> Bootstrapping...
remote: -----> Installing platform packages...
remote:        - php (7.2.8)
remote:        - ext-gd (bundled with php)
remote:        - ext-mbstring (bundled with php)
remote:        - nginx (1.8.1)
remote:        - apache (2.4.34)
remote: /app/tmp/buildpacks/2eb21e9db12e182f49d4d2f512fbbb1b5c0e2f2cc7316a571d4c31b476916dc7f9372d5a597490761325ac6b221f8f381804151a7b10729a06a6f76e022e52de/export: line 1: export: SSL/TLS': not a valid identifier
remote: /app/tmp/buildpacks/2eb21e9db12e182f49d4d2f512fbbb1b5c0e2f2cc7316a571d4c31b476916dc7f9372d5a597490761325ac6b221f8f381804151a7b10729a06a6f76e022e52de/export: line 1: export:disabled.': not a valid identifier
remote:  !     Push rejected, failed to compile PHP app.
remote: 
remote:  !     Push failed
remote: Verifying deploy...

アレコレしても全然直らない
で、最終的に空のリポジトリ作って1ファイルずつ調べたら原因はここでした

composer.json

    "config": {
        "disable-tls": true, ← コレ!!!
        "secure-http": false,
        "vendor-dir": "data/vendor",
        "platform": {
            "php": "5.4"
        }
    },

“disable-tls”: false に直したら解決、時間返してくれ。。。